eval(function(p,a,c,k,e,r){e=function(c){return(c<a?'':e(parseInt(c/a)))+((c=c%a)>35?String.fromCharCode(c+29):c.toString(36))};if(!''.replace(/^/,String)){while(c--)r[e(c)]=k[c]||e(c);k=[function(e){return r[e]}];e=function(){return'\\w+'};c=1};while(c--)if(k[c])p=p.replace(new RegExp('\\b'+e(c)+'\\b','g'),k[c]);return p}('u.v=C;Z.10(6(){g e=D 11({12:6(){3.m=N();3.O=N();3.j(\'13\',6(a){h=D 14("[\\<|\\>|\\"|\\\'|\\%|\\;|\\(|\\)|\\&]","i");7!h.w(a)});3.j(\'15\',6(a){h=/^\\S[\\S ]{2,16}\\S$/;7 h.w(a)});3.j(\'17\',6(a){h=/^(\\d|-)?(\\d|,)*\\.?\\d*$/;7 h.w(a)});3.j(\'18\',6(a){h=/^[a-q-r-9.E-]+@([a-q-r-9.-]+\\.)+[a-q-r-9.-]{2,4}$/;7 h.w(a)});3.j(\'F\',6(a){g b,i;5(a.s==C){7 8}n{g c=a.s.P(\'G\');x(i=0,b=c;i<b.H;i++){5(b[i].Q)7 8}7 f}});3.j(\'I\',6(a){g b,i;5(a.s==C){7 8}n{g c=a.s.P(\'G\');x(i=0,b=c;i<b.H;i++){5(b[i].Q)7 8}7 f}});g d=$$(\'J.J-k\');d.y(6(a){3.R(a)},3)},j:6(a,b,c){c=(c==\'\')?8:c;3.m[a]={19:c,z:b}},R:6(b){$A(b.K).y(6(a){a=$(a);5((a.T()==\'G\'||a.T()==\'1a\')&&a.l(\'t\')==\'1b\'){5(a.U(\'k\')){a.1c=6(){7 u.v.V(3.J)}}}n{a.1d(\'1e\',6(){7 u.v.k(3)})}})},k:6(a){5(a.l(\'t\')=="F"||a.l(\'t\')=="I"){}n{5($(a).U(\'1f\')){5(!($(a).L())){3.o(f,a);7 f}}}g b=(a.M&&a.M.1g(/k-([a-q-r-9\\E\\-]+)/)!=-1)?a.M.1h(/k-([a-q-r-9\\E\\-]+)/)[1]:"";5(b==\'\'){3.o(8,a);7 8}5((b)&&(b!=\'W\')&&(3.m[b])&&$(a).L()){5(3.m[b].z($(a).L())!=8){3.o(f,a);7 f}}n 5((b)&&(b!=\'W\')&&(3.m[b])){5(a.l(\'t\')=="F"||a.l(\'t\')=="I"){5(3.m[b].z(a.s)!=8){3.o(f,a);7 f}}}3.o(8,a);7 8},V:6(b){g c=8;x(g i=0;i<b.K.H;i++){5(3.k(b.K[i])==f){c=f}}$A(3.O).y(6(a){5(a.z()!=8){c=f}});7 c},o:6(b,c){5(!(c.p)){g d=$$(\'1i\');d.y(6(a){5(a.l(\'x\')==c.l(\'1j\')){c.p=a}})}5(b==f){c.X(\'B\');5(c.p){$(c.p).X(\'B\')}}n{c.Y(\'B\');5(c.p){$(c.p).Y(\'B\')}}}});u.v=D e()});',62,82,'|||this||if|function|return|true|||||||false|var|regex||setHandler|validate|getProperty|handlers|else|handleResponse|labelref|zA|Z0|parentNode|type|document|formvalidator|test|for|each|exec||invalid|null|new|_|radio|input|length|checkbox|form|elements|getValue|className|Object|custom|getElementsByTagName|checked|attachToForm||getTag|hasClass|isValid|none|addClass|removeClass|Window|onDomReady|Class|initialize|username|RegExp|password|98|numeric|email|enabled|button|submit|onclick|addEvent|blur|required|search|match|label|id'.split('|'),0,{}))
